First Port Targeted at Enabling HDTVs to
Include On-board Transmission of Spatial Audio
WiSA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: WISA), a leading provider of
immersive, wireless sound technology for intelligent devices and
next-generation home entertainment systems, today announced a
licensing program for its high-quality, multichannel wireless WiSA
E software. The program is targeted towards HDTV platforms and
speaker manufacturers. As consumer demand for an enhanced audio
experience grows, WiSA Technologies projects that a low-cost
licensing program making WiSA’s audio technology readily available
to industry platforms will enable an ecosystem of affordable and
interoperable immersive audio products.
WiSA E is currently being ported to Amlogic’s low-cost HDTV
platform. WiSA Technologies is also working with several leading
IoT chip manufacturers, including Realtek and Espressif, to run
WiSA’s audio software on low-cost Wi-Fi chips.

WiSA E is interoperable audio software/IP designed to be ported
to TV SoC platforms enabling built-in transmission capabilities of
high-quality multichannel audio streams. To enable an ecosystem of
interoperable speakers, WiSA E is also designed to run on low-cost
3rd-party 5GHz IoT chips/modules. The WiSA Association, a 70+
industry member organization, is currently developing an
interoperability test specification to ensure that products using
WiSA E technology work seamlessly with each other.

WiSA E is sampling this quarter (Q4, 2022) with select Beta
customers. WiSA E software product business licensing discussions
have begun; WiSA E software porting to platforms is being supported
in USA, Asia, and India. WiSA Technologies expects WiSA E software
to be in production during 2023.
